Iranian Foreign Minister Abbas Araghchi has sharply criticized U.S. policy in the ongoing conflict, accusing President Donald Trump of escalating the war for political reasons.

In an interview with CBS’s Face the Nation, Araghchi said Iran had not asked for a ceasefire and would continue defending itself.

“No, we never asked for a ceasefire, and we have never even asked for negotiations. We are ready to defend ourselves as long as it takes,” the Iranian foreign minister said.

Araghchi also blamed Washington for what he described as an “illegal war.”

“People are being killed only because President Trump wants to have fun,” he said, referring to comments he claims the U.S. president made about sinking ships and striking targets.

“This is a war of choice by President Trump and the United States, and we are going to continue our self-defense,” Araghchi added.

The Iranian minister also dismissed suggestions that Tehran should return to negotiations with Washington.

“We were talking with them when they decided to attack us. There is no good experience talking with Americans. We were negotiating, and they attacked us. So what is the point of going back to talks again?” he said.

Araghchi stressed that Iran considers the conflict an act of aggression and said the country is prepared to continue resisting as long as necessary.
